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 5 -- United States Patent no. 12,240,202, issued on March 4, was assigned to Andersen Corp. (Bayport, Minn.).

"Laminated glass retention system" was invented by Adam Richard Rietz (Lake St. Croix Beach, Minn.), Craig Michael Johnson (North Oaks, Minn.), Katherine April Stephan Graham (Inver Grove Heights, Minn.), Scott Edward Thom (White Bear Township, Minn.), Eric Matthew Mueller (Cottage Grove, Minn.), Drew Adam Pavlacky (Lakeland Shores, Minn.) and Jared Shanholtzer (Saint Paul Park, Minn.).
